Tongue reconstruction: Rebuilding mobile three-dimensional structures from immobile two-dimensional substrates, a fresh cadaver study.

R Michael BaskinHadi SeikalyRaja SawhneyDeepa DananMartha BurtSherif IdrisMohamed ShamaBrian BoycePeter T Dziegielewski
Published in: Head & neck (2019)
Typical dimensions and shapes of common tongue defects were determined. It is conceivable that customizing reconstructive flaps based on these data will increase the accuracy of neo-tongue reconstruction, and thus, improve functional outcomes.
